Roman Abramovich on EU sanctions list

by

The European Union (EU) on Tuesday blacklisted Russian billionaire Roman Abramovich and other oligarchs in a new round of sanctions imposed following Russia’s invasion of Ukraine.

The sanctions also bar trade with Russian oil companies Rosneft, Transneft and Gazprom Neft, excluding those related to fossil fuels and other raw materials, according to the EU’s official newspaper.

Abramovich’s name is included in the European Union’s fourth package of sanctions that will freeze assets for those over-rich Russians believed to be linked to President Putin.

Sanctions imposed last week in the UK have frozen all cash and assets held in the UK.

His shares on the London Stock Exchange can not be sold, he can not pay dividends, nor can he benefit from the planned sale of the Chelsea football team, for 3 billion pounds. He has also been barred from entering the United Kingdom.
